Hislop, Werner Kirsch","submitted_at":"2019-05-20T05:55:07Z","abstract_excerpt":"We prove that the local eigenvalue statistics at energy $E$ in the localization regime for Schr\\\"odinger operators with random point interactions on $\\mathbb{R}^d$, for $d=1,2,3$, is a Poisson point process with the intensity measure given by the density of states at $E$ times the Lebesgue measure. This is one of the first examples of Poisson eigenvalue statistics for the localization regime of multi-dimensional random Schr\\\"odinger operators in the continuum.
